Eugene Mason “Coach” Myers, 88, of Chesterfield died Oct. 20, 2024. Mr. Myers earned his bachelor's degree in physical education and mathematics from Southeast Missouri State University and his master's in administration from Kirksville Missouri State University. He was a longtime Herculaneum United Methodist Church member and their treasurer for many years. He also taught both youth and adult Sunday School. After moving to Eureka, he was involved in the Eureka United Methodist Church. He served on committees, continued to teach Sunday School, mentored those going through confirmation, used his woodworking skills to frame the stained-glass windows made by the church members and made candle holders for those baptized at the church. He taught high school math and algebra and was the high school boys’ basketball coach at Herculaneum High School for 13 years followed by 13 more years at Eureka High School. He was later the assistant men's basketball coach at Maryville University for 10 years. He was known as a mentor and inspiration for many young men who also called him friend and spent numerous hours talking to and listening to his players; making time for them even when he knew dinner was probably on the table waiting for him at home. Mr. Myers was a member of 4H, NEA, MSTA and Gemmer Muzzle-Loading Gun Club. He was also active in the Senior Olympics until he was 75 years old. He had many first-place finishes in basketball at the local and regional Senior Olympics. At the national level of Senior Olympics, his team took 2nd place in the 3 on 3 basketball. He will be remembered for never knowing a stranger. Born Jan. 6, 1936, in Festus, he was the son of the late Paul and Hester (Frissell) Myers.
